The DeLalio Elementary School Parent Teacher Association group poses for a photo with U.S. Marine Corps Sgt. Maj. Douglas Gerhardt, right, the sergeant major of Marine Corps Air Station (MCAS) New River, after receiving an award from Col. Garth W. Burnett, left, commanding officer, MCAS New River, and at the MCAS New River Volunteer Appreciation Reception at the New River Marina on MCAS New River, in Jacksonville, North Carolina, April 19, 2023. In order to achieve a group silver award, volunteers must have donated a minimum of 250 hours of service over the course of one calendar year. At this event, base leadership recognizes the volunteer's commitment each year to community service and to Marines, Sailors, and families across the installation. (U.S. Marine Corps photo by Cpl. Zeta Johnson)
